Furch say...
Our baritone line features instruments that are built to expand and enhance the sound spectrum of your performance. The redesigned Baritone body-shape combined with a scale length of 710 mm both contribute to the deep tones produced, and with the balance and power typical of Furch Guitars. This setup adjusted for ‘B’ tuning delivers tones and harmonics unavailable from an ordinary guitar. The body is made from all solid materials and an Open-Pore coating gives this model a deeper, more natural sound of Western Red Cedar top and African Mahogany back and sides.
- Solid TopWestern Red Cedar
- Solid Back And SidesAfrican Mahogany
- BindingArtificial Tortoise
- BridgeEbony
- SaddleTUSQ Fully Compensated
- String Spacing at the Bridge55 mm
- StringsElixir Bronze Nanoweb 16-70
- Body FinishOpen-Pore
- Pick GuardArtificial Tortoise
- Nut Width45mm
- Scale Length710 mm
- Fingerboard MaterialEbony
- Fingerboard Radius400 mm
- Headstock OverlayEbony
- Neck MaterialAfrican Mahogany
- Machine HeadsFurch Machine Chrome Gear Ratio 1:15
- NutTUSQ
- String Spacing at the Nut38 mm
- StringsElixir Bronze Nanoweb 16-70
- Neck & Headstock FinishOpen-Pore
